Wehrlein surprised to fend off Ericsson

– Manor's Pascal Wehrlein admitted he was surprised to beat Sauber rival Marcus Ericsson after finishing 16th at the Singapore Grand Prix.Manor had been adrift of its rivals throughout the course of the weekend but two-stopping Wehrlein overhauled his three-stopping opponent and repelled the Swede across the final stint.Wehrlein ultimately crossed the line just half a second clear of Ericsson and delighted in the achievement."This was definitely the toughest race of the season," said Wehrlein, who competed in Singapore for the first time."I was pushing hard from start to finish, but particularly from the mid-point of the race to make sure we kept Ericsson...
